Grander Rum Rye Finish

Review #1137; Rum #456 Grander is a bottler that bottles rum with no additives. The spirit is distilled in Panama from molasses and aged for 12 years in ex-bourbon barrels. It is then finished in ex-rye casks for 15 months before being bottled. Distillery: Las Cabras Bottler: Grander Region: Panama Still: Column Still Cask: Ex-Bourbon 12 years, finished in ex-rye

Bologne Le Distillat Black Cane

Review #1135; Rum #454 Hailing from the Bologne distiller on Guadeloupe, this fresh pressed cane juice is made from 100% black cane varietal sugar cane that is left to rest several months after distillation before being bottled at natural strength.
